網頁2024年5月14日 · A shim is a thin, wedge-shaped piece of metal that is used to fill gaps between objects. Shims are commonly used to adjust for a better fit, provide support, or create a level surface. Shims made of brass and brass alloys are also used as spacers to fill gaps between wear-prone parts. 網頁Shims are best made of 316 stainless steel in applications involving chemicals, petrochemicals, food, and marine use. The austenitic grade 316 stainless steel offers exceptional strength and outstanding ductility, toughness, and corrosion resistance. Adding molybdenum improves the overall corrosion resistance of grade 316 stainless steel. 網頁2011年8月4日 · Shims take all of the load and the column rotates over the shims - The rotation will eventually be resisted by the grout. 2. 網頁2024年8月23日 · Shims typically take up mechanical space or slack in a static load environment. When used in a static environment, rotational issues such as friction and … A shim is a thin and often tapered or wedged piece of material, used to fill small gaps or spaces between objects. Shims are typically used in order to support, adjust for better fit, or provide a level surface. Shims may also be used as spacers to fill gaps between parts subject to wear. 查看更多內容 Many materials make suitable shim stock (also often styled shimstock), or base material, depending on the context: wood, stone, plastic, metal, or even paper (e.g., when used under a table leg to level the table surface). … 查看更多內容 In automobiles, shims are commonly used to adjust the clearance or space between two parts. For example, shims are inserted into or under bucket tappets to control valve clearances. Clearance is adjusted by changing the thickness of the shim. In assembly and … 查看更多內容 • Byrnes, Joe. 網頁2024年12月18日 · A shim stock is a roll of thin gauge metal or foil used to create shims. Thin gauge cut sheet metal may be as thin as 0.0005 inch (0.0127 millimeter) to allow for fine positioning adjustments.
